Mobile terminal and coil antenna module

  • US 10,148,001 B2
  • Filed: 07/13/2017
  • Issued: 12/04/2018
  • Est. Priority Date: 03/04/2015
  • Status: Active Grant

1. A mobile terminal comprising:

  • a first case comprising a battery loading portion;

    a battery positioned in the battery loading portion;

    a second case coupled to the first case and positioned over the battery;

    a switch;

    a coil antenna module positioned between the second case and the battery,wherein the coil antenna module comprises;

    an insulating sheet;

    a first coil, a second coil, and a third coil, each positioned on the insulating sheet;

    a magnetic sheet positioned over the first coil, the second coil, and the third coil; and

    a controller electrically coupled to the coil antenna module and configured to;

    provide a near field communication (NFC) function using the first coil;

    automatically charge the battery using the third coil when the mobile terminal is placed at a wireless charging device, wherein during the automatically charge of the battery, the switch is open preventing the second coil to connect to a payment module;

    cause the switch to close to connect the second coil to the payment module according to a payment function;

    transmit a payment signal by the second coil after the switch is closed;

    provide the NFC function with a frequency band of 13.56 MHz or more;

    provide the payment function with a frequency band of 100 kHz or less; and

    provide the automatically charge of the battery with a frequency band from 100 kHz to 300 kHz.
